应用程序
android实例教程
android实例教程Android实例教程是指通过具体的实例来教授Android编程和开发的过程。下面是一个关于如何编写一个简单的Android应用程序的实例教程。第一步是创建一个新的Android项目。在Android Studio中,选择"File"菜单,然后选择"New",然后选择"New Project"。输入应用程序的名称和其他相关信息,然后点击"Next"。第二步是选择目标设备和最低...
Android程序设计简介
Android程序设计简介Android程序设计简介1. 概述Android程序设计是指开发适用于Android系统的应用程序的过程。Android系统是由Google开发的一个开源移动操作系统,广泛应用于智能方式、平板电脑等移动设备。在Android平台上开发应用程序可以为用户提供各种各样的功能和服务,满足不同需求。2. Android开发环境2.1 Android StudioAndroid...
移动端APP开发入门指南
移动端APP开发入门指南移动APP越来越受到用户的青睐,而且随着智能手机、平板电脑等移动设备的普及,移动APP市场的规模也在不断扩大。那么,对于初学者来说,如何入门移动端APP开发呢?以下是一些基础的指南供大家参考。一、学习编程语言作为App开发的前置条件,编程语言的学习是必不可少的。至于选择哪种编程语言,一般来说,主流的移动端APP开发主要分为iOS和Android两个阵营,各有其特点和优势。因...
Java程序设计入门
Java程序设计入门Java是一种面向对象的编程语言,它被广泛用于开发各种应用程序,包括Android应用程序、网站、游戏和企业应用程序等。Java语言简单易学,具有很强的可移植性和安全性,因此受到了广泛的欢迎。如果您想学习Java编程,那么本文将为您提供一些入门知识和建议。Java安装与环境设置在开始学习Java编程之前,您需要安装Java开发工具包(JDK)和集成开发环境(IDE)。JDK是J...
Android4高级编程[修改版]
第一篇:Android 4高级编程Android 4高级编程目录第1章Android简介11.1 一些背景信息21.1.1 不远的过去21.1.2 未来的前景21.2 对Android的误解31.3 Android:开放的移动开发平台31.4 原生Android应用程序41.5 Android SDK的特征51.5.1 访问硬件(包括摄像头、GPS和传感器) 51.5.2 使用Wi-Fi、蓝牙技术...
Android 4高级编程(第3版)
Android 4高级编程(第3版)《Android 4高级编程(第3版)》基本信息原书名:Professional Android 4 Application Development作者: (英)Reto Meier 译者: 佘建伟 赵凯丛书名: 移动开发经典丛书出版社:清华大学出版社ISBN:9787302315582上架时间:2013-4-23出版日期:2013 年4月开本:1...
Android程序设计简介简版
Android程序设计简介Android程序设计简介1. 概述Android是由Google开发的基于Linux内核的移动操作系统,主要用于移动设备如智能方式和平板电脑等。Android操作系统提供了丰富的应用程序编程接口(API),使开发者可以开发各种各样的应用程序,满足用户的需求。Android程序设计是指使用Java编程语言开发Android应用程序的过程。借助Android Studio等...
Android程序设计简介-无删减范文
Android程序设计简介Android程序设计简介1. 引言Android是一个广泛使用的移动操作系统,由Google开发并基于Linux内核。它提供了丰富的软件库和开发工具,使开发人员能够构建各种各样的应用程序。本文将介绍Android程序设计的基本概念和技术,为初学者提供一个简单的入门指南。2. Android应用程序的结构Android应用程序的结构由四个主要组件组成:Activity(活...
SecurID 4.0 快速入门指南(iOS 和 Android 应用)说明书
适用于iOS和Android应用程序的SecurID4.0快速入门指南适用于iOS和Android的SecurID4.x将RSA SecurID Authenticate应用程序和SecurID软件令牌的功能结合到一个方便的令牌中,您可以使用它安全地登录公司帐户。从SecurID4.x开始,您可以从单个应用程序访问您的SecurID软件令牌以及使用批准(推送通知)、Authenticate Tok...
移动应用程序开发入门指南
移动应用程序开发入门指南随着科技的发展,越来越多的人开始使用移动设备,而移动应用程序的需求也越来越大。如果您想成为一名移动应用程序开发者,那么本文将为您提供一些基础知识,帮助您入门移动应用程序开发。第一步:语言移动应用程序可以使用多种编程语言进行开发,例如Java、Objective-C、Swift、Python等等。其中Java在Android开发中使用较多,Objective-C和Swift在...
《Android开发从入门到精通》
《Android开发从入门到精通》1.引言Android系统是目前全球使用最广泛的操作系统之一,以应用程序的形式出现,其应用广泛,不仅遍布于手机、平板电脑,甚至于智能电视、车载电脑等领域。在Java语言的支持下,Android开放了API接口,用户可以利用Java语言进行Android应用程序的开发,这就是Android开发。本文将详细讲解Android开发的基础知识,包括Java编程、Andro...
Android应用开发全程指南
Android应用开发全程指南第一章:Android应用开发概述Android应用开发是指针对Android操作系统进行应用程序开发的过程。本章将介绍Android应用开发的基本概念、发展历程以及开发环境的搭建。Android是由Google开发的一种基于Linux内核的开源移动操作系统,它提供了丰富的开发工具和开发框架,使开发者能够快速、高效地构建各类Android应用程序。第二章:Androi...
《Android开发入门》
《Android开发入门》Android开发入门随着移动互联网的飞速发展,以及智能手机用户数量的不断增加,Android系统也成为了全球范围内最受欢迎的移动操作系统之一。这就给Android开发者带来了巨大的机遇,越来越多的人开始学习和使用Android开发技术。然而,对于不少想入门Android开发的初学者来说,经常会遇到一些困难和挑战。一方面,在众多的开发工具和技术中,如何选取适合自己的方法并...
中科创达Android 开发工程师岗位笔试选择题附笔试高分技巧
中科创达Android 开发工程师岗位笔试(选择题)附笔试技巧中科创达公司Android开发工程师岗位的笔试题目一、选择题(共10题,每题4分)1. 在Android系统中,以下哪个选项是正确的Activity生命周期方法?A. onPause()B. onStop()C. onPauseAndStop()D. noneOfTheAbove参考答案B. onStop()2. 在Android中,使...
Android应用程序调试技巧
Android应用程序调试技巧Android应用程序开发是一个非常繁忙的任务,并且存在很多问题,其中最重要的问题是应用程序的调试。Android应用程序开发人员需要掌握一些技巧来帮助他们调试他们的应用程序。以下是一些常用的Android应用程序调试技巧。一、日志输出应用程序调试的一个重要技巧是使用日志输出。Android应用程序提供了一个Logcat工具,该工具可帮助开发人员输出应用程序的日志。日...
基于模拟器的Android自动化测试
基于模拟器的Android自动化测试近年来,随着智能手机用户的不断增加,Android操作系统也得到了广泛应用。对于开发者来说,如何保证应用程序的质量显得尤为重要。传统的手动测试方法已经不能满足开发者对测试的需求,因此自动化测试成为了一种趋势。Android自动化测试有许多工具可以使用,其中基于模拟器的自动化测试被认为是相对简单而有效的方法。本文将介绍基于模拟器的Android自动化测试,并探讨如...
如何使用Android Studio进行布局设计和界面编写
使用Android Studio进行布局设计和界面编写随着移动应用的快速发展,Android平台成为开发人员的首选之一。而在Android开发中,布局设计和界面编写则是开发过程中的重要环节。本文将介绍如何使用Android Studio进行布局设计和界面编写,帮助初学者顺利入门。一、概述在开始之前,我们先了解一下Android Studio。Android Studio是谷歌发布的官方集成开发环境...
android studio猴子摘桃实验报告
android studio猴子摘桃实验报告Android Studio猴子摘桃实验报告概述本报告旨在介绍Android Studio猴子摘桃实验的目的、原理、实验过程、结果以及结论。实验目的本实验的主要目的是为了让学生们熟悉使用Android Studio的相关工具和环境,并且让学生们了解自动化软件测试的基本概念和方法。实验原理猴子摘桃实验是一种常用的自动化软件测试方法,它主要是通过随机生成各种...
VSCode调试Android应用程序方法
VSCode调试Android应用程序方法随着移动应用的快速发展,开发者们需要一个高效、便捷的工具来调试Android应用程序。VSCode是一款功能强大的代码编辑器,不仅提供了优秀的代码编辑功能,还支持调试Android应用程序。本文将介绍使用VSCode调试Android应用程序的方法,方便开发者们更高效地进行应用程序的开发和调试工作。一、准备工作在开始使用VSCode调试Android应用程...
fballocationtracker原理解析
fballocationtracker是一个用于Android应用程序内存调优的用户空间跟踪工具。它在Android的dalvik/ART运行时中,使用C++和Java代码实现了精确的内存分配跟踪。fballocationtracker主要用于追踪内存分配的性能,帮助开发者出内存泄漏和不必要的内存分配。本文将对fballocationtracker的原理进行深入解析,希望能帮助开发者更好地理解和...
allocation tracker使用方法 -回复
allocation tracker使用方法 -回复Allocation Tracker 使用方法引言:当我们开发 Android 应用程序时,我们经常需要跟踪内存分配情况,以确保没有内存泄漏或者过度使用内存,从而提高应用程序的性能和稳定性。Allocation Tracker 是一个 Android 开发工具,它可以帮助我们分析和监控应用程序在运行时的内存分配情况。本文将详细介绍 Allocat...
seledroid用法详解
android模拟点击seledroid用法详解Seledroid是一个用于自动化Android应用程序的工具。它是基于Selendroid的一个分支,专门针对Android设备进行测试和自动化。在本篇文章中,我将详细介绍Seledroid的用法,并为您提供一步一步的指南。一、什么是Seledroid?Seledroid是一个用于自动化Android应用程序的工具,也可以理解为一个提供了许多API...
monkey工具的使用
monkey工具的使用Monkey是一个Android上的压力测试工具,可以模拟用户交互行为,如滑动屏幕、点击按钮、输入文字等,从而测试应用程序的稳定性和性能表现。以下是使用Monkey工具的步骤:1. 准备工作:将Monkey工具添加到系统路径中,并在设备或模拟器上开启USB调试模式。2. 编写Monkey命令:打开终端或命令提示符窗口,输入如下命令:$ adb shell monkey [op...
基于Android系统的Air程序开发
开发Android版AIR应用程序翻译人员名单第一章入门指南本章包括有关开发环境的设置信息。还有一个Hello World实例。Hello World例子开发和测试Android版AIR程序的流程1.编写ActionScript代码。2.创建一个标准的AIR应用描述文件(使用2.5命名空间).3.编译应用程序。4.使用ADT把应用程序打包成Android包(.apk)。5.用Android ADB...
Android应用程序开发(第二版)课后习题答案
第一章Android简介1.简述各种手机操作系统的特点.答案:目前,手机上的操作系统主要包括以下几种,分别是Android、iOS、Windows Mobile、Windows Phone 7、Symbian、黑莓、PalmOS和Linux。(1)Android是谷歌发布的基于Linux的开源手机平台,该平台由操作系统、中间件、用户界面和应用软件组成,是第一个可以完全定制、免费、开放的手机平台。A...
androidstudio的用法
androidstudio的用法 AndroidStudio是Android开发者最熟悉的编程工具之一。它是谷歌官方提供的一款定制化的集成开发环境,主要用于开发Android应用程序。本文将分步骤阐述如何使用AndroidStudio。 一、安装AndroidStudio首先,需要从下载最新的AndroidStudio软件,安装到电脑上。...
如何在Android设备上安装和运行自己的应用程序(十)
android模拟点击如何在Android设备上安装和运行自己的应用程序随着智能手机的普及,越来越多的人开始尝试自己开发和运行Android应用程序。无论是为了个人乐趣还是商业目的,学会在Android设备上安装和运行自己的应用程序是非常重要的。本文将分享一些简单而实用的步骤,帮助你迈出开发自己应用程序的第一步。1. 开发环境准备在开始之前,你需要准备好开发环境。首先确保你的电脑已经安装了Java...
如何在软件开发中处理跨浏览器兼容性问题
如何在软件开发中处理跨浏览器兼容性问题现在,越来越多的软件应用程序都需要在多个不同的浏览器中运行,这就给软件开发带来了一定的挑战。因为不同的浏览器之间可能存在差异,这些差异可能会导致应用程序在不同的浏览器中表现不同。为了确保应用程序能够正常运行,开发人员需要专门处理跨浏览器兼容性问题。在本文中,我们将分享一些解决跨浏览器兼容性问题的最佳实践。1.了解浏览器差异在处理浏览器兼容性问题之前,开发人员需...
如何在自动化测试中使用Docker
如何在自动化测试中使用DockerDocker是一种基于容器技术的开源平台,可实现应用程序的自动化部署和容器化。自动化测试是指将测试过程中的重复性步骤交给计算机自动化执行的过程。在日常工作中,我们可能需要使用Docker来帮助我们进行自动化测试。本文将介绍如何在自动化测试中使用Docker。一、 Docker是什么?Docker是一种面向应用程序的轻量级容器化平台,可为应用程序和服务提供最好的协作...
利用Jenkins与Selenium实现Web自动化测试(八)
使用Jenkins和Selenium进行Web自动化测试现如今,互联网技术的飞速发展催生了各种Web应用程序的涌现。为了保证这些应用程序的质量和性能,Web自动化测试变得极为重要。本文将探讨如何利用Jenkins与Selenium来实现Web自动化测试,提高测试效率和准确性。一、引言 测试的重要性Web应用程序的质量对于企业成功十分关键。而Web自动化测试是一种能够更好地检查Web应用的有效方法。...